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ology Solution: Group attractions into distinct areas…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ology each with a spanning corridor…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ology that serves as “file folder” containing turns to attractions.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ology Attraction signing is forced to “behave itself” along these corridors.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ology Process can be reiterated with a sub-area . . .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ology leading to turns for a sub-grouping of attractions.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ology EXAMPLE: Erie, PA divided into “predictive” file folders. Local attractions are “naturally” associated with “Bayfront” or “Downtown” or “Beaches” or “Airport”.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ology EXAMPLE: Upper Eastern Shore, MD Highway sign (left) and local road sign (right) Wayfinding Methodology : Wayfinding Methodology Nashville’s Advance in Area/Corridor Wayfinding: DMS signs to switch corridors due to event-related road closures.
